It's based on 4.11-rc2 as I noticed that tip/x86/core is rather outdated, and Linus is fine with basing off of his tagged releases. ] With the issues of gcc screwing around with the mcount stack frame causing function graph tracer to panic on x86_32, and with Linus saying that we should start deprecating mcount (at least on x86), I figured that x86_32 needs to support fentry. First, I renamed mcount_64.S to ftrace_64.S. As we want to get away from mcount, having the ftrace code in a file called mcount seems rather backwards. Next I moved the ftrace code out of entry_32.S. It's not in entry_64.S and it does not belong in entry_32.S. I noticed that the x86_32 code has the same issue as the x86_64 did in the past with respect to a stack frame. I fixed that just for the main ftrace_caller. The ftrace_regs_caller is rather special, and so is function graph tracing. I realized the ftrace_regs_caller code was complex due to me aggressively saving flags, even though I could still do push, lea and mov without changing them. That made the logic a little nicer. Finally I added the fentry code. I tested this with an older compiler (for mcount) with and without FRAME_POINTER set. I also did it with a new compiler (with fentry), with and without FRAME_POINTER. I tested function tracing, stack tracing, function_graph tracing, and kprobes (as that uses the ftrace_regs_caller).
